Jones scores season-high 27 as Cats rip LSU

Posted: Updated:

BATON ROUGE, La. (AP) - Terrence Jones highlighted a 27-point performance with a 13-0 run on his own and No. 1 Kentucky pulled away in the second half for a 74-50 win over struggling LSU Saturday night.

Anthony Davis had 16 points and 10 rebounds despite briefly leaving the game when he hurt his right shoulder in a scramble for a loose ball. Darius Miller added 13 points including three 3-pointers for Kentucky (21-1 7-0 Southeastern), which has won 13 straight games. Johnny O'Bryant III had 12 points and nine rebounds for LSU (12-9, 2-5), which has lost four of its last five.

Storm Warren had 11 points for the Tigers, including an alley-oop dunk that briefly got the Tigers within a point at 25-24 late in the first half, before the Wildcats pulled away.
